Project Completion: Mayesbrook We’ve officially handed over the newly transformed space at Mayesbrook, and what a meaningful one it’s been. Known internally as the 'Rectory', this project involved the careful refurbishment of a listed building and the construction of a new gym and corridor extension. But beyond the brickwork, this was always about creating a place where young people with complex needs can feel safe, supported, and understood. Mayesbrook is a vital resource supporting families across the London Borough of Barking and Dagenham, thoughtfully designed to nurture emotional regulation, independence and family connection. Every space has been considered with care, from therapy rooms to breakout areas, ensuring it supports both the young people and the professionals working alongside them. Seeing it complete, ready to welcome its first cohort, is a proud moment for the whole team. The building may have had many names in its time but it now has a clear purpose and a bright future. Auburn Group has partnered with HARP Homelessness Charity , Southend’s leading homelessness charity, to support an exciting new pilot programme: HARP Construct. The initiative helps people who’ve experienced homelessness gain the skills, confidence, and qualifications to build sustainable careers in construction. Why it’s needed: Across the UK, construction faces a major skills shortage – with over 250,000 new workers needed by 2028. At the same time, thousands of people are seeking a way back into stable employment and independence. HARP Construct bridges that gap – giving motivated individuals the opportunity to learn, grow, and contribute to the industry’s future. Over the next year, two 12-week programmes will help people who’ve previously experienced homelessness gain valuable skills, confidence, and hands-on experience in the construction industry. Each participant is vetted as “ready to work” and supported through tailored training, mentoring, and on-site exposure. Auburn will be contributing by providing: ◾ PPE for participants ◾ Site tours of the Cliffs Pavilion project ◾ Career talks and Q&A sessions ◾ Mock interviews with our teaThis collaboration isn’t about charity – it’s about opportunity. It’s about giving people the chance to rebuild, re-skill, and reimagine their future through construction. We’re proud to play a small part in this big idea – helping to turn hard hats into hope.

We are delighted to share Auburn Group's recent collaboration with St Joseph's Care Home. The collaboration began with Auburn Group conducting a detailed assessment of the care home, focusing on: 🦺 Electrical and Mechanical Systems: Ensuring optimal function and adherence to safety standards. 👩🚒 Fire Safety Systems: A thorough review to guarantee resident safety. Building Integrity: Including crucial fire stopping measures. 🏡 Feasibility of a 22-Bed Wing Extension: Planning for future expansion to accommodate more residents. External Windows and Roof: Assessing for insulation, security, and weather protection. The first phase of refurbishment focused on the care home's back of house areas, particularly the kitchen and laundry rooms. Despite the challenges of working in a live environment, Auburn Group successfully modernised these critical areas with minimal disruption to the residents. This phase highlighted our expertise in not only construction but also in executing projects considerately in sensitive settings. This partnership between St Joseph's Care Home and Auburn Group underscores a commitment to enhancing the living conditions and safety of residents, showcasing a fusion of compassionate care with high-standard facilities.

Auburn Group Awarded PCSA for Trinity School's New Living & Learning Centre Auburn Group Ltd is proud to announce our latest project: the PCSA on the construction of a new, bespoke Living & Learning Centre for Trinity School. A Specialist SEN School for Cognition and Learning in Dagenham, Essex. This project is more than just a building; it's a commitment to enhancing the learning environment for students with special educational needs. The new LLC will address the challenges of the current spread-out campus, bringing together facilities and staff in a centralised, efficient location. With a focus on community integration, the new centre will also reshape the school's presence along Heathway, creating a more inviting and accessible space for the community. Auburn Group Secures PCSA for the Old Rectory Project We're proud to announce that Auburn Group Ltd has been awarded the Pre-Construction Services Agreement for the Old Rectory Project by London Borough of Barking and Dagenham. The Old Rectory, formerly a library, is now designated to be transformed into a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ND) learning facility. The Old Rectory Project is more than just a development; it's a commitment to nurturing the social and personal growth of youth. Focusing on those who are non-verbal and need intensive care, this project is designed to empower them to realise their full potential. As we lead the PCSA of this vital facility, our goal is to create a space where young people can thrive in a supportive environment, fostering their independence and enhancing family bonds.
